Burundi | Control of Corruption: Percentile Rank, Lower Bound of 90% Confidence Interval

Control of Corruption captures perceptions of the extent to which public power is exercised for private gain, including both petty and grand forms of corruption, as well as "capture" of the state by elites and private interests. Percentile rank indicates the country's rank among all countries covered by the aggregate indicator, with 0 corresponding to lowest rank, and 100 to highest rank. Percentile ranks have been adjusted to correct for changes over time in the composition of the countries covered by the WGI. Percentile Rank Lower refers to lower bound of 90 percent confidence interval for governance, expressed in percentile rank terms.

Burundi | Control of Corruption: Percentile Rank, Lower Bound of 90% Confidence Interval
1996 6.98924732
1998 5.34759378
2000 0.53191489
2002 2.64550257
2003 5.29100513
2004 5.91133022
2005 6.34146357
2006 3.41463423
2007 1.45631063
2008 3.39805818
2009 1.43540668
2010 0.95238096
2011 0.94786727
2012 0
2013 0
2014 1.92307687
2015 1.90476191
2016 3.33333325
2017 1.90476191
2018 0.47619048
2019 0
2020 0
2021 0
2022 0
